Cleaning Machine Overflows And Floodings.


  • 1. Switch off the power at the breaker (to all affected areas of your residence).

  • 2. Unplug the washer.

  • 3. Shut off the water system to the washer.

  • 4. Do not use the cleaning machine till removed by an electrician or licensed repairman.

  • Shut off the Power.


    Turn of the breaker where the washing device is. It is essential to ensure the washing machine is off. Water is a conductor, and also doing this action ensures no person struggles with electrocution. Besides, you need to not utilize your washing machine until a professional service technician has actually inspected it.

    Turn Off Water.


    You have to switch off the water supply of the device. Whether it overruns for unidentified factors, breaks down in the reduced pipes, or ruptures the primary hose, you will be taking care of remarkable quantities of water. If the neighborhood supply line to the washer doesn't close it off, you have to switch off the major water shutoff outside your home.

    Call the Pros.


    If you suspect the problem is with your water line, you need to call a qualified plumber. Nonetheless, if you are not exactly sure, call a washer service technician for a fast assessment. This person can tell you finest what the problem is. It could be an issue with the maker itself or the pipelines attaching to the equipment.

    Record the Damage.


    Before tidying up this emergency flooding situation, you have to document whatever. Take notes, photos, and videos. It would certainly be best if you had all of this as evidence to support your insurance coverage claims. After that you can call your homeowner's insurance service provider to inspect what various other requirements they require to process your demand.

    Take Out the Standing Water.


    As you await the plumber or repair service service technician ahead, you need to handle the flooding. If your washer is in the cellar with considerable flooding, you require a submersible pump to get the water. You can lease or borrow this. However, if it happens in the middle of the evening, the old pail approach will additionally work. Use numerous containers to manually dispose out the water. It would certainly be best if you did this as soon as possible, as the longer the water stays, the a lot more comprehensive the damages.

    Dry the Area as Long As Feasible.


    After taking out the standing water, obtain mops or old towels to draw out as much water from the floor or carpeting. Keep the home windows available to flow the air. You may additionally make use of electric fans to speed up the drying out process. Keep in mind, water will certainly create mold as well as mold development which is unsafe to your health. If you really feel that the situation is too much to take care of, you can also seek water elimination services from a repair company. Your insurance policy claim can likewise aid spend for this solution, so just ask.
    Keep in mind, a broken washer with leaking pipelines will cause disastrous damages because of the enormous quantities of water it can unload. Thus, it would help to have your equipment and also water lines inspected annually. You can look for help from a trusted plumber to change your supply line hoses. Doing assessments prevents stressful breakdowns and pricey breakdowns.

    Washing Machine Flood Inspection Help & Tips


    The source of the water from a washing machine loss could be from a water supply line, a waste water line, or a faulty part inside the unit itself such as the pump. Safety should always be the first concern. When water is present there is always the potential for an electrical hazard. If you are unsure, it s best not to enter the area.



    If you can safely enter the area, the hot and cold water supply valves should be turned off behind the unit. If you cannot safely reach the valves or if a valve has failed, shut off the main water valve to the property. Once the water supply has been shut off the water supply lines will need to be detached and drained into a container. If the washing machine has water in the drum and it is/was not possible to run the spin or drain cycle, the drum will need to be drained manually with a cup or small bucket.



    The waste water drain line will need to be removed from the drain inlet, and the dryer vent ducting will need to be detached. The washing machine and dryer will need to be moved in order to allow inspection of the walls and floor around the unit. Without a using a Dolly this can be difficult.



    Once the units have been uninstalled, the walls, baseboard, and flooring materials can be tested for abnormal or high moisture content.
